Early life

Anne Wilson was born in the Kentucky city of Lexington. For the most of her childhood, Wilson was brought up in a Christian environment and went to a Presbyterian church every Sunday.

Career

Anne Wilson has secured a record deal with Capitol Christian Music Group, which was announced late last year. Wilson made her debut with the track ” My Jesus “, which was published on April 16, 2021. In the following years, “My Jesus” would go on to become Wilson’s breakout smash single, reaching the top of the Christian Airplaychart as well as the Hot Christian Songschart. Wilson’s first long play, My Jesus, was published on August 6, 2021, and it was her first theatrical production (Live in Nashville).

Wilson’s new album, “I Still Believe in Christmas,” will be published on October 29, 2021.

Chartbreaker: How Christian Artist Anne Wilson Made History With Breakout Hit ‘My Jesus’

Anne Wilson grew up in Kentucky, where she studied piano and dance. She never contemplated pursuing a career in music; instead, she aspired to be an astronaut. That all changed in 2017, when her older brother Jacob, then 23 years old, was killed in a vehicle accident. “I’d never written a song before, and I’d never performed in front of anyone until the funeral,” Wilson recounts. Wilson sang the song “What a Beautiful Name” by Hillsong Worship at the service, and she recalls it as “the first time I felt God calling me to music.” Encouraged by friends and family, Wilson uploaded a video of herself performing the song on YouTube.

Kentucky’s Anne Wilson is rising star in Christian contemporary music; brother’s death inspired her career

Written by Mark Maynard Kentucky Today (Kentucky Today.com) Anne Wilson was a person who was constantly aiming for the heavens. She just had no idea that she would end up as a modern Christian music recording artist. Before a tragic event in her life changed her life trajectory, the 19-year-old Kentucky native had aspirations of pursuing an astronaut career. After her brother died in a road accident four years ago, she discovered a part of herself that she had never realized she possessed: a deep singing voice that she believes may be used for God in ways she could never have imagined.
